Many people find that exposure to blue light from screens can cause eye strain and disrupt sleep, especially during evening hours. This is where night shift settings on Windows and Mac come into play, offering a simple way to reduce blue light and improve your screen’s comfort. When you enable night shift or similar features, you’re fundamentally adjusting your screen’s color calibration to emit warmer, less intense hues. This blue light reduction helps ease eye fatigue and makes it easier to fall asleep after screen time, but it also requires some fine-tuning to work effectively.
The key to making the most of night shift features is understanding how to set the right parameters. On Windows, you’ll find the “Night light” setting, which can be scheduled or turned on manually. When you activate it, your screen shifts to warmer tones, decreasing blue light emissions. You can adjust the strength of this effect through a slider, allowing for more or less color shift depending on your comfort level. On Mac, the feature is called “Night Shift,” and you can customize its schedule and color temperature via System Preferences. It also lets you set a timer or have it turn on automatically at sunset, aligning with natural circadian rhythms.
While these settings are designed to help, it’s important not to rely solely on them to solve eye strain or sleep issues. Instead, think of night shift as part of a broader strategy that includes proper screen distance, regular breaks, and good lighting in your environment. When adjusting screen color calibration, aim for a warm tone that feels comfortable without being overly yellow or orange. Too much warmth might distort colors and affect your ability to work or view images accurately, especially if you need precise color reproduction for tasks like photo editing or graphic design. Conversely, too little adjustment won’t provide sufficient blue light reduction.

How Does Night Shift Affect Screen Calibration and Color Accuracy?
Night Shift reduces blue light exposure by adjusting your screen’s color temperature, which can slightly affect calibration and color accuracy. You’ll notice warmer tones, making colors appear softer and less vibrant. While this change helps lessen eye strain and improve sleep, it might compromise precise color work. For tasks requiring accurate colors, consider disabling Night Shift or calibrating your display afterward to maintain supreme color fidelity.

How Does Night Shift Interact With Third-Party Display Apps?
Night Shift can conflict with third-party display apps, causing display calibration issues or color inconsistencies. When you use both, third-party apps may override or interfere with Night Shift’s adjustments, leading to unpredictable color temperatures. To prevent this, verify these apps are compatible or disable one when using the other. Checking for updates or settings within third-party software can help minimize conflicts and maintain accurate display calibration.
